How to Up-Cycle Your Drawers

Up-cycle some old drawers to bring a new pop of colour into your bedroom.

Step One:

Choose paint that will work well with the colour scheme in your room. Try matching the bedspread or contrasting to the wall colour.

Step Two:

Pull out the drawers and lightly sand the outside and front of each to ensure the surface you’ll be painting is smooth.

Don’t forget to lay out a protective sheet on the floor to minimise mess. Now you’re ready to paint!

Step Three:

Make sure you have gloves and a protective mask and apply your first coat of paint.

Step Four:

Allow the paint to dry for at least 30 minutes and then apply a second coat.

Tip - Leave for 24 hours before placing the drawers back into the nightstand – so you don’t scratch the paint while moving it.  

 Now you’re ready to style your new nightstand!
